PHP Class Webmozart\KeyValueStore\Tests\JsonFileStoreTest

Since: 1.0
Author: Bernhard Schussek ([email protected])
Inheritance: extends AbstractSortableCountableStoreTest
Show file Open project: webmozart/key-value-store

Public Methods

Method Description
provideScalarValues ( )
testClearThrowsWriteExceptionIfWriteFails ( )
testCountThrowsReadExceptionIfReadFails ( )
testCreateMissingDirectoriesOnDemand ( )
testEscapeAmpersand ( )
testEscapeDoubleQuote ( )
testEscapeGtLt ( )
testEscapeSingleQuote ( )
testEscapeSlash ( )
testEscapeUnicode ( )
testExistsThrowsReadExceptionIfReadFails ( )
testGetMultipleOrFailThrowsExceptionIfNotUnserializable ( )
testGetMultipleOrFailThrowsReadExceptionIfInvalidJsonSyntax ( )
testGetMultipleOrFailThrowsReadExceptionIfReadFails ( )
testGetMultipleThrowsExceptionIfNotUnserializable ( )
testGetMultipleThrowsReadExceptionIfInvalidJsonSyntax ( )
testGetMultipleThrowsReadExceptionIfReadFails ( )
testGetOrFailThrowsExceptionIfNotUnserializable ( )
testGetOrFailThrowsReadExceptionIfInvalidJsonSyntax ( )
testGetOrFailThrowsReadExceptionIfReadFails ( )
testGetThrowsExceptionIfNotUnserializable ( )
testGetThrowsReadExceptionIfInvalidJsonSyntax ( )
testGetThrowsReadExceptionIfReadFails ( )
testKeysThrowsReadExceptionIfReadFails ( )
testNoEscapeAmpersand ( )
testNoEscapeDoubleQuote ( )
testNoEscapeGtLt ( )
testNoEscapeSingleQuote ( )
testNoEscapeSlash ( )
testNoEscapeUnicode ( )
testPrettyPrint ( )
testRemoveThrowsWriteExceptionIfWriteFails ( )
testSetDoesNotSerializeArrayssIfDisabled ( )
testSetDoesNotSerializeNull ( )
testSetDoesNotSerializeStringsIfDisabled ( )
testSetSupportsBinaryArrayValues ( $value )
testSetSupportsBinaryObjectValues ( $value )
testSetSupportsBinaryValues ( $value )
testSetSupportsScalarValues ( $value )
testSetThrowsWriteExceptionIfWriteFails ( )
testSortThrowsReadExceptionIfReadFails ( )
testSortThrowsWriteExceptionIfWriteFails ( )
testTerminateWithLineFeed ( )

Protected Methods

Method Description
createStore ( )
setUp ( )
tearDown ( )

Method Details

createStore() protected method

protected createStore ( )

provideScalarValues() public method

public provideScalarValues ( )

setUp() protected method

protected setUp ( )

tearDown() protected method

protected tearDown ( )

testClearThrowsWriteExceptionIfWriteFails() public method

testCountThrowsReadExceptionIfReadFails() public method

testCreateMissingDirectoriesOnDemand() public method

testEscapeAmpersand() public method

public testEscapeAmpersand ( )

testEscapeDoubleQuote() public method

testEscapeGtLt() public method

public testEscapeGtLt ( )

testEscapeSingleQuote() public method

testEscapeSlash() public method

public testEscapeSlash ( )

testEscapeUnicode() public method

public testEscapeUnicode ( )

testExistsThrowsReadExceptionIfReadFails() public method

testGetMultipleOrFailThrowsExceptionIfNotUnserializable() public method

testGetMultipleOrFailThrowsReadExceptionIfInvalidJsonSyntax() public method

testGetMultipleOrFailThrowsReadExceptionIfReadFails() public method

testGetMultipleThrowsExceptionIfNotUnserializable() public method

testGetMultipleThrowsReadExceptionIfInvalidJsonSyntax() public method

testGetMultipleThrowsReadExceptionIfReadFails() public method

testGetOrFailThrowsExceptionIfNotUnserializable() public method

testGetOrFailThrowsReadExceptionIfInvalidJsonSyntax() public method

testGetOrFailThrowsReadExceptionIfReadFails() public method

testGetThrowsExceptionIfNotUnserializable() public method

testGetThrowsReadExceptionIfInvalidJsonSyntax() public method

testGetThrowsReadExceptionIfReadFails() public method

testKeysThrowsReadExceptionIfReadFails() public method

testNoEscapeAmpersand() public method

testNoEscapeDoubleQuote() public method

testNoEscapeGtLt() public method

public testNoEscapeGtLt ( )

testNoEscapeSingleQuote() public method

testNoEscapeSlash() public method

public testNoEscapeSlash ( )

testNoEscapeUnicode() public method

public testNoEscapeUnicode ( )

testPrettyPrint() public method

public testPrettyPrint ( )

testRemoveThrowsWriteExceptionIfWriteFails() public method

testSetDoesNotSerializeArrayssIfDisabled() public method

testSetDoesNotSerializeNull() public method

testSetDoesNotSerializeStringsIfDisabled() public method

testSetSupportsBinaryArrayValues() public method

testSetSupportsBinaryObjectValues() public method

testSetSupportsBinaryValues() public method

public testSetSupportsBinaryValues ( $value )

testSetSupportsScalarValues() public method

public testSetSupportsScalarValues ( $value )

testSetThrowsWriteExceptionIfWriteFails() public method

testSortThrowsReadExceptionIfReadFails() public method

testSortThrowsWriteExceptionIfWriteFails() public method

testTerminateWithLineFeed() public method